Special features: stamp gallery; radio "Shakespeare of Harlem"; radio "The rhyme of the ancient dodger".
Disc 1: An historical overview. Paul Robeson : the tallest tree in our forest -- Press conference USA with the Rev. Dr. Martin Luther King -- Let us break bread together. Disc 2: The arts. Scott Joplin : king of ragtime composers -- W.C. Handy -- Paul Laurence Dunbar : America's first black poet -- Lou Stovall -- Larry Lebby and stone lithography -- Contemporary visual expression -- The negro in entertainment. Disc 3: Sports & science. 1936 Olympic highlights -- The brown bomber -- Joe Louis vs Max Schmeling -- The negro in sports -- From dreams to reality : a tribute to minority inventors -- Jan Matzeliger -- The negro in industry.
18 documentaries on the African American contributions to arts, sports, science and more.
